Our Rooms
At Meru Nest, there are no room numbers and no standard rooms.
Each room carries the name of a local bird and reflects its own character, light, and rhythm — shaped by the house and its surroundings rather than by uniform design.
Our rooms are designed as calm, intimate retreats, where atmosphere and intention matter more than size or formality. Natural materials, soft earth tones, and handmade details create a warm, understated environment that feels personal, grounded, and quietly refined.
At the heart of each room is a handcrafted wooden bed, draped with a mosquito net and dressed in high-quality linens and individually selected textiles. Instead of conventional hotel bedding, fabrics are chosen to complement each room’s colours, textures, and mood — subtle, tactile, and thoughtfully composed.
The bathrooms follow the same philosophy of simplicity and authenticity. Newly tiled and equipped with modern rain showers, they are clean, functional, and intentionally understated. Their design reflects everyday life in Tanzania rather than international hotel standards — offering a space for refreshment that is practical, grounded, and honest in character.
Carefully selected furnishings and lighting complete the rooms, guided by a timeless design language that balances comfort, craftsmanship, and local identity.
